It is a multi-format extractor but the key part is that it has support for RARv3 format and is a replacement for the non-free unrar (in RPM Fusion).   unar and lsar are just command line tools but file-roller does support it since 3.6.  Once unar gets built, I intend to push the packages changes in file-roller (BR on json-glib-devel and requires on unar) for Rawhide and Fedora 19.  I have already tested it with a variety of RAR files and it works fine.
